Uploaded image for project: 'Teiid Designer'
  1. Teiid Designer
  2. TEIIDDES-2480

LDAP importer fails silently when no location is explicitly entered for the new model

    XMLWordPrintable

    Details

      Description

      LDAP import fails silently when no location is entered for the "Source Model Definition" section's "Location" field on the first page of the wizard. This occurs even when using the context menu to initiate from a specific project or child object level. The wizard functions as expected until you finish, at which point the model is never generated. No error dialog or failure notification is presented to the user. checking error log shows:

      java.lang.NullPointerException
      at org.teiid.designer.modelgenerator.ldap.RelationalModelBuilder.createNewModelResource(RelationalModelBuilder.java:65)
      at org.teiid.designer.modelgenerator.ldap.RelationalModelBuilder.modelEntries(RelationalModelBuilder.java:109)
      at org.teiid.designer.modelgenerator.ldap.ui.wizards.LdapImportWizardManager.createModel(LdapImportWizardManager.java:384)
      at org.teiid.designer.modelgenerator.ldap.ui.wizards.LdapImportWizard$1.run(LdapImportWizard.java:158)
      at org.eclipse.jface.operation.ModalContext$ModalContextThread.run(ModalContext.java:122)

        Gliffy Diagrams

          Attachments

            Issue Links

              Activity

                People

                • Assignee:
                  phantomjinx Paul Richardson
                  Reporter:
                  mshirley Marc Shirley
                • Votes:
                  1 Vote for this issue
                  Watchers:
                  7 Start watching this issue

                  Dates

                  • Created:
                    Updated:
                    Resolved: